Issue with Menu selection values
List, Here's the issue. I have a bunch of drop down menus. The alias value is a word and each has a corresponding Selection value and ID which is a number. So High,Med,Low alias values would be 3,2,1 respectively. I have an active link on a button which then sets an Integer field with the number value and adding the values from each selection drop down. In the WUT, I have no issues. However, using the mid tier, I get an error: Data types are not appropriate for arithmetic operation (ARERR 9339) Should I be using a different field instead of an integer?
